[![][Cover]][Packt] These examples cover the main features of JUnit 5, such as: * JUnit 5 tests lifecycle. * Assertions. * Tagging and filtering tests. * Conditional test execution. * Nested and repeated tests. * Migration from JUnit 4. * Dependency injection. * Dynamic tests. * Test interfaces. * Test templates. * Parameterized tests. * Parallel execution. * Ordered tests. Moreover, the integration with third-party technologies is also illustrated with examples, concretely: * Mockito (popular mock framework). * Spring (Java framework aimed to created enterprise applications based on dependency injection). * Docker (container platform technology). * Selenium WebDriver (test automation library for web applications). * Appium (test automation library for mobile devices). * Android (open source mobile operating system based on Linux). * REST services (using REST Assured, Retrofit2, or WireMock). # JUnit 5 versions This repository has different tags, one per minor version of JUnit 5. Currently, the available tags are the following: * `5.0`: Examples using JUnit 5.0.3. The examples of the book [Mastering Software Testing with JUnit 5] are based on this version. * `5.1`: Examples using JUnit 5.1.1. * `5.2`: Examples using JUnit 5.2.0. * `5.3`: Examples using JUnit 5.3.2. * `5.4`: Examples using JUnit 5.4.2. * `5.5`: Examples using JUnit 5.5.2. * `5.6`: Examples using JUnit 5.6.3. * `5.7`: Examples using JUnit 5.7.2. * `5.8`: Examples using JUnit 5.8.2. * `5.9`: Examples using JUnit 5.9.3. * `5.10`: Examples using JUnit 5.10.0. * `5.11`: Examples using JUnit 5.11.0. * `5.12`: Examples using JUnit 5.12.0. # Complete example The project [Rate my cat!] contains a sample web application based on Spring Boot (Spring MVC, Thymeleaf, and Spring Data JPA) with a complete set of JUnit 5 tests (unit with Mockito, integration with Spring, and end-to-end tests with Selenium). # About Mastering JUnit 5 (Copyright © 2017-2025) is a project created and maintained by [Boni García] and licensed under the terms of the [Apache 2.0 License].
